Ticket: BRK-207. The Larkspool broker upgrade to v5 stalled because the credentials used by the Dovetail relay expired mid-rollout. New team members: always verify credential expiry before scheduling broker maintenance. A fresh credential has been issued and must be placed in the relay's environment file. The new key for the Dovetail relay service appears below.

API key for yahig-tadup: kto7_ubizbYm

Subject: Key rotation for the Quillbus upgrade

Hey! Welcome aboard — quick heads-up before you dig into the broker work. We're upgrading Quillbus from 3.x to 4.0 this sprint, and the old publisher credentials won't survive the migration. Everything on the legacy vhost gets revoked Friday, so don't bother wiring those into your local setup. The new key already has publish and consume scopes for the staging cluster. Use the one below until the rotation tooling lands.

gateway credential: kto3_qfe

Minutes — Management Meeting

Prepared for the incoming director. Topic: possible acquisition of Greyfen Analytics. Due diligence 70% complete. Valuation gap remains; Greyfen seeks a premium. Integration risks flagged by Ops. Decision deferred to next month. Talla Nyberg leads negotiations. Our walk-away position is stated below.

board note of fawig-kagup: Only 48 of the 435 pilot accounts renewed Rusion, so a churn review is set for September 12. Fenwynox Logistics is in early talks to buy Sorielek Systems for about $117.8 million.